Popularized by European motorcyclists in the 1960s for its slim shape and tapered sleeves, the café racer is a sleek alternative to the traditional biker jacket. Our version is crafted with roughout suede and finished with signature snap closures.
- Size medium has a 26" front body length, a 25" back body length, an 19.25" shoulder, a 45.5" chest, and a 36" sleeve length. Sleeve length is taken from the center back of the neck and changes 1" between sizes.
- Stand collar. Snapped throat tab. "Polo"-engraved snaps. Full-zip front.
- Long sleeves with gusseted zip vents at the cuffs. Ventilating metal grommets at the underarms.
- Left chest zip pocket. Two front waist zip pockets.
- Buckled tabs at the waist.
- Fully lined.
- Shell: leather. Body lining: cotton. Sleeve lining: cupro, cotton. Spot clean. Imported.
- Due to the natural characteristics of this material, the coloring may rub off onto fabrics and upholstery.
